Ms. O tells Otis and Olympia a story about the most feared villains in Odd Squad history.
When Olympia finds the 2013 Most Odd list in a cabinet at Odd Squad, she wonders why the list isn't made anymore. Ms. O tells Olympia and Otis the story of the Total Zeroes, who were once the least odd villains on the list. Their power was to subtract zero from things, and because any number minus zero is still zero, their powers didn't do anything.
